Solve. 5q^2 + 20 = 425

Step-by-step explanation:

Isolate 5q² by subtracting 20 from both sides

5q² = 405 ( divide both sides by 5 )

q² = 81 ( take the square root of both sides )

q = ± [tex]\sqrt{81}[/tex] = ± 9

Solution is { - 9, 9 }
